My target Market are Teenage Girls and their mothers. This is what Mineral Girlz is designed for. I just started a yahoo group for  Teenage Girls and need some Topic Ideas for discussions that would appeal to the teenage girl.  The idea is to focus on beauty the natural way, but I also want it to be a place on building relationships and allow for teenage girls to chat about their problem areas. What kinds of topics, activities should I do to get my site active?

Where do I need to frequent as far as social networking places (free ones)?

 

any ideas would be appreciated.

Hello.  I`m a single guy in my thirties so I don`t have ANY suggestions about teenage girl topics.  But I wanted to throw out some thoughts about your Yahoo group.

I took a look at your site to get an idea of what MineralGirlz is about.  I think its great that you want to provide a place for girls to talk about various things.

I have little experience with Yahoo Groups but can you create different categories of topics?  Categories like Fashion, School, Boys, etc. seem appropriate for teen girls.  This might help you break down your concepts into ways to start conversations going.

Other than a Yahoo Group, have you thought about perhaps starting a blog?  There are other ways to get into conversations with your market than a Yahoo Group.  Just a thought.

I must say though, it strikes me odd that if you are at a loss for topics, why is it that you want to run an online community?

First suggestion: Teenage girls are not on Yahoo! groups.

They are on MySpace, Facebook, Xanga, Ning, and texting their little thumbs away. Most of them don`t even have the need for email addresses anymore - they live in their little social networking worlds and contact each other that way.

I agree with Steve - you have a serious gap to overcome here. You`d be better off hiring a couple of teen girls as your "spokepeople", pay them to blog and start topics, and move off Yahoo! and on to a better platform for the age group you are trying to reach.
